Tether is extending the use of token gold XAU₮ from holding and trading to encrypted lending. Under Ledn ' s published arrangements, the platform has added support for the XAU₮, which users can now hold and trade on the platform and which will be followed by the opening of the XAU₮ loan service as collateral.
Ledn has added XAU₮ support
Ledn says that XAU₮ has been included with Bitcoin, USD₮ and USA₮ in the platform support. It is planned that XAU₮ mortgage lending will be launched later in 2026. At that time, the holder may obtain liquidity without selling token gold.
This model is similar to the existing bitcoin mortgage structure of the Platform. Users retain their exposure to lower-level assets, while obtaining stabilization currency or other funds through collateral.
Ledn also stated that the customer collateral would be held at 1:1 and would not be loaned again or used to obtain the proceeds. This arrangement responds to external concerns about collateral security and re-commitment for markets that experienced the 2022 risk event of encrypted lending platforms.
XAU₮ continues to expand.
Tether has been adding gold-related operations for the past year. The company data show that, as of 31 March 2026, the XAU₮ reserve amounted to 707,747.139 golden ounces, up from 520,089.350 gold ounces at the end of 2025.
According to Tether, the market value of XAU₮ rose from approximately $2.25 billion to over $3.3 billion in the first quarter of the year. Each XAU₮ corresponds to a gold ounce of physical gold, which is stored in a Swiss vault.
The amount of $23 billion in gold mentioned in the article corresponds to Tether's broader gold holdout. Reuters had previously reported that, as at the end of March, Tether held approximately 132 tons of gold for the USDT reserve, valued at close to $19.8 billion; the corresponding gold for XAU₮ was about 22 tons.
Moving from holding instruments to encumbered assets
Gold mortgages are not new in traditional finance, and similar models have long been used by banks and precious metals trading institutions. Tether and Ledn are now trying to move this to a chain-to-asset market where tokenization of gold is not only a tool, but also a collateral for borrowing.
For users, the attractiveness of such products is that they can retain gold price exposures while obtaining short-term liquidity without having to sell assets directly. If the service goes online as planned, the role of XAU₮ in the encryption market will be further extended to the lending scene from purely token gold products.
Tether is also continuing to increase the use of XAU₮ in recent times. Previously, Tether and Fasset had introduced Visa cards with XAU₮ back-to-back, in an attempt to extend tokenization of gold to the area of payment.
